Summary
The unicode character "𬨑" at code point U+2CA11 is a CJK (Chinese Japanese Korean) ideogram meaning "the empty space of a wheel, rim of a wheel, felly, or felloe". It is a character in the CJK Unified Ideographs Extension E block and is part of the Han script. The character is an other letter. The UTF-8 encoding of "𬨑" is 0xF0 0xAC 0xA8 0x91 and the UTF-16 encoding is 0xD872 0xDE11.
